Android開發(fā)常用命令整理
一些命令,不常用就忘記了,特整理在這里,忘了就查查。。 * 創(chuàng)建Android虛擬設(shè)備(AVD) android create avd -n –name –t –target(1、2、3) * ddms(其文件管理功能) * 創(chuàng)建sdcard mksdcard –l label <size> <sdFilePath> * 啟動(dòng)模擬器 emulator –avd –name * 啟動(dòng)具有sdcard的模擬器 emulator –avd –name –sdcard <sdFilePath> * adb功能太多了,常用的install、uninstall、shell等。 * 指定特定設(shè)備,發(fā)送命令 adb -s <serial number> install/uninstall.... * 殺死adb服務(wù) adb kill-server * 重啟adb服務(wù) adb start-server * 啟動(dòng)一個(gè)activity adb shell am start <intent>/<-n classname> * 發(fā)送一個(gè)廣播 adb shell am broadcast <intent> * Monkey測試 adb shell monkey -v -p pkgname millisecond * 生成密鑰 * Release下編譯 * apk簽名 * 校驗(yàn)簽名 * apk對齊 * apk對齊校驗(yàn) * 更改apk默認(rèn)安裝路徑 0 由App自行決定軟件能否安裝在SD卡 1 強(qiáng)制全部App安裝在ROM內(nèi) 2 強(qiáng)制全部App安裝在SD卡
$pm setInstallLocation 0